Summary:

Now On Demand

We believe a concentrated portfolio of high quality companies with a sustainable cash flow advantage can provide investors with competitive risk-adjusted returns over a full market cycle. Our focus on the integration of deep fundamental and ESG research together improves our decision making process and provides us with an informational edge that can help drive outperformance over time. Please join portfolio manager Mike Poggi and Katherine Kroll, our Director of ESG Equity Research and Strategy for a discussion on:

  • How we define “value”
  • Our fully integrated sustainability framework that seeks to identify companies with sustainable free cash flow advantages
  • Our approach to valuation and capital discipline

Speakers:

Michael Poggi, CFA Michael Poggi, CFA Large-Cap Sustainable Value, Portfolio Manager Brown Advisory

Mike is the portfolio manager for the Large-Cap Sustainable Value Strategy. He joined Brown Advisory in 2003 as an equity research analyst and has covered multiple sectors and industries with a primary focus on value companies across the market cap spectrum. For the past 13 years, Mike has also been dedicated to the Small-Cap Fundamental Value strategy as an associate portfolio manager while covering the industrial, material and energy sectors.

Katherine Kroll Katherine Kroll Director of Equity ESG Research & Strategy Brown Advisory

Katherine is the Director of Equity ESG Research and Strategy. She is responsible for ESG integration, adoption and research across Brown Advisory’s institutional equity investment strategies. Additionally, she leads the ESG engagement strategy and supports the expansion of sustainable investment solutions at Brown Advisory.

Previously, Katherine was an Investment Specialist for the Large-Cap Sustainable Growth Strategy and a Senior Institutional Sustainable Investing Specialist. She was recognized as SRI’s “30 Under 30” sustainable investing professionals and was a leader of Women Investing for a Sustainable Economy (WISE). Prior to joining Brown Advisory, Katherine led the shareholder advocacy efforts for Green Century Capital Management.

Katherine achieved her MBA from The University of Texas, McCombs School of Business.
